Licensing Standards That Matter for New Zealand

For New Zealand players, the licensing landscape is nuanced. The country does not issue its own online casino licences, but it permits offshore operators to consent NZ customers as long as they comply with the Gambling Act 2003. In practice, this means players rely on licences from established jurisdictions that apply customer protection and fair play. The most respected licences we consider are from the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), which imposes strict anti-money laundering (AML) procedures, affordability checks, and a mandatory code of conduct for socially responsible gambling. The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) is another strong option, known for its robust dispute resolution process and regular audits. Some newer casinos hold licences from the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ority or the Alderney Gambling Control Commission—both are respected, but we verify their current enforcement stance. We do not automatically reject casinos licensed in Curacao, as many reputable operators make use of that licence as a secondary one, but we apply extra scrutiny because the regulatory oversight is igniter. For our 2026 guide, we prioritise casinos that hold at the least ane top-tier licence and are transparent about it.

Licensing and Regulation

When evaluating new online casinos for UK players in 2026, the world-class and most critical factor is licensing and regulation. Every reputable betting site must hold a valid licence from the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), which ensures strict adherence to standards of fairness, player protection, and responsible gambling. The UKGC mandates that operators undergo rigorous background checks, maintain segregated user funds, and accede to regular audits by independent testing agencies such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s. This means that any new igaming platform appearing on the UK market without a UKGC licence should be avoided, as it likely operates in a grey or unregulated space. Beyond the licence itself, players should look for clear terms and conditions, transparent bonus policies, and evidence of anti-money laundering procedures. A trustworthy new gambling site will prominently display its licence number and provide links to its regulatory organic structure, along with striking details for dispute resolution. In the rapidly evolving UK marketplace of 2026, where new brands launch oft, the presence of a UKGC licence is non-negotiable for a safe and fair gaming experience.

Licensing is not merely a formality; it is the bedrock of customer confidence. The UKGC requires all licensees to implement advanced age verification systems, preventing underage gambling and ensuring that only legally eligible players can access real-money games. Additionally, operators must adhere to strict advertising standards, avoiding misleading promotions that could entice players beyond their means. For example, a casino must clearly state wagering requirements, maximum bet limits when using bonuses, and any game restrictions that apply. In 2026, the UKGC has further tightened rules around VIP schemes, banning incentives that encourage high-risk behaviour. Players should verify that a new casino’s terms explicitly prohibit contrary withdrawals or arbitrary confiscation of win. The licence also obligates casinos to participate in GamStop, the national self-exclusion intrigue, allowing players to block themselves from all UKGC-licensed sites. A casino that fails to integrate with GamStop or delays withdrawal requests beyond 24 hours raises serious red flags. Furthermore, the UKGC conducts mystery shopping and unannounced inspections to ensure compliance; any breach can result in fines or licence revocation. For instance, in 2025, several operators were penalised for failing to prevent money laundering through anonymous cryptocurrency deposits. Thus, checking the UKGC’s public register for any sanctions or warnings against a new casino is a prudent tread before depositing. At long last, a valid UKGC licence is the strongest indicator that a casino operates with integrity, but players must also scrutinise the finer details of its regulatory compliance to ensure a secure and enjoyable gaming surround.

How to Gamble Responsibly Without Losing Fun

Gambling is strictly for adults aged 18 and over. All UK-licensed casinos are regulated by the Gambling Commission (UKGC). To help curb your play, you can make use of the national self-exclusion scheme GAMSTOP, which blocks access to all participating sites. For free, confidential assist, contact GamCare or BeGambleAware via the National Gambling Helpline on 0808 8020 133. E’er localise deposit and time limits, and handle gambling as entertainment, not a way to make money. Never salmon portland chase losses — if you’re struggling, seek help immediately.
